Understanding The Sims 4 Requirements
Before diving into whether your MacBook Pro can handle The Sims 4, it’s essential to understand the game’s system requirements. The minimum and recommended requirements set the stage for an optimal gaming experience.
Minimum System Requirements
- OS: macOS 10.11 (El Capitan) or later
- Processor: Intel Core i5
- Memory: 4 GB RAM
-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 650 or AMD Radeon HD 7770
- Storage: At least 15 GB of free space
Recommended System Requirements
- OS: macOS 10.12 (Sierra) or later
- Processor: Intel Core i7
- Memory: 8 GB RAM
-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 660 or AMD Radeon HD 7850
- Storage: At least 18 GB of free space
Assessing Your MacBook Pro
The next step in determining whether your MacBook Pro can run The Sims 4 is to assess its specifications. MacBook Pro models vary widely in terms of hardware, so knowing your model’s capabilities is crucial.
Finding Your MacBook Pro Specifications
You can check your MacBook Pro’s specifications by following these steps:
- Click on the Apple logo in the top-left corner of your screen.
- Select “About This Mac.”
- In the Overview tab, you’ll find your model information, processor type, RAM, and operating system.
Key Specifications to Consider
Focus on these aspects to determine your MacBook Pro’s compatibility with The Sims 4:
- Processor: The newer the model, the better the processing power.
- RAM: Aim for at least 8 GB for a smoother experience.
- Graphics Card: A dedicated graphics card will enhance performance.
- Storage: Ensure you have enough free space for the game and its expansions.

Troubleshooting Tips for Running The Sims 4 on MacBook Pro
Even if your MacBook Pro meets the requirements, you might still encounter issues while playing The Sims 4. Here are some common problems and their solutions:
Issue 1: Game Crashing or Freezing
If your game crashes or freezes, try the following:
- Ensure your macOS is up to date.
- Check for game updates through your game platform.
- Close other applications to free up system resources.
Issue 2: Low FPS (Frames Per Second)
To improve your game’s performance:
- Lower the graphic settings in the game options.
- Disable unnecessary background applications.
- Consider upgrading your RAM if possible.
Issue 3: Installation Problems
If you have trouble installing the game:
- Ensure your device has enough storage space.
- Restart your MacBook Pro and try the installation again.
- Check your internet connection if downloading from an online platform.
